The Interview Show with Sprïng #165

from The Interview Show · host Scott Wood

New Vancouver indie act Sprïng was birthed from the destruction of favourite local spazz-punk band the SSRIs. When I found out that the new project would be called “Sprïng,” I wondered if the band was determined to hide from people on the internet. I sat down to chat with the guys in Sprïng in the band’s kitchen and the boys assured me that if you manage to type the “ï” that the band is the only google search result–along with some World of Warcraft thing. Then they taught me how to type an “i” with an umlaut, among many other things. Listen to our chat! Tracks played on the show... 1) Sprïng, Celebrations (2014) “Follow” 2) SSRIs, Effeminate Godzilla​-​Sized Wind Chimes (2010) “Rows” 3) Sprïng, Celebrations (2014) “Storyteller” 4) Sprïng, Celebrations (2014) “Pastel” ALL songs CANCON
